Emmanuel Eboue has grabbed a fresh chance to put himself in the shop window - this time with the Arsenal Legends.
Eboue played for the Gunners' legends side at Real Madrid on Sunday.
The 34-year-old appeared alongside greats such as Nicolas Anelka, David Seaman, Sol Campbell and Ray Parlour for the star-studded charity match.
Last Christmas, Eboue admitted he had been left homeless following a divorce.
“I want God to help me," he told the Mirror. “Only he can help take these thoughts from my mind.
“I can't afford the money to continue to have any lawyer or barrister.
"I am in the house but I am scared. Because I don't know what time the police will come.
“Sometimes I shut off the lights because I don't want people to know that I am inside. I put everything behind the door."
Eboue has since been offered youth coaching jobs in Turkey and Italy.
